Osogbo – January 30, 2025 – The Osun Sustainable Development Goals (SDG) Creative Conference concluded successfully, showcasing a vibrant cultural tour.

This engaging event highlighted Osun State’s rich heritage while emphasizing sustainability, innovation, and community empowerment throughout.

Participants embarked on their journey at the historic Afin-Ilu Palace, gaining insights into the royal drummer’s significance in Yoruba culture.

This visit effectively showcased music’s essential role in preserving heritage and fostering community identity among participants.

Next, the group visited the Adire Oodua Textile Hub, where they learned about the intricate art of Adire and Batik fabric-making.

This segment emphasized the importance of sustainable local fashion in promoting economic development through indigenous craftsmanship and creativity.

Following this, participants toured the Scrap Art Museum of Dotun Popoola, witnessing waste materials transformed into stunning art pieces.

This experience reinforced recycling’s value while promoting a circular economy through the innovative repurposing of materials.

Overall, the tour illustrated the conference’s core themes, allowing participants to connect with practical applications of sustainable development.

Consequently, attendees departed with a renewed appreciation for how local industries can drive positive change in their communities.

In a significant boost to Osun State’s creative economy, Sir Demola Aladekomo made a generous announcement.

Specifically, he revealed a ₦25 million donation from Smart City Plc.

This funding is set to establish a Content Creation Studio at the SDG Skills Acquisition Centre in Dagbolu, significantly enhancing content production for digital creators.

Furthermore, the Osun SDG Conference organizers expressed gratitude to Jumbo Food for supplying meals for 500 participants.

Their generous contribution significantly fostered an atmosphere that encouraged interaction and collaboration.
